HP All-in-One - 22-df0023w

I want to upgrade my ram but im not sure of my max capacity.. any recommendations and advice would be greatly appreciated.

I understand you want to know the upgraded options for the HP All-in-One 22-df0023w comes with 4 GB of DDR4-2400 SDRAM installed and can support up to 16 GB of RAM in total. This model typically has 2 SODIMM slots, allowing you to upgrade the memory easily.
 

Recommendations for Upgrading RAM:

Check Existing RAM Configuration:

  • Since your PC comes with 4 GB of RAM, check if it occupies a single slot or both. You can either add another module if there's an empty slot or replace the existing one with a larger capacity module.
  • Use the system information or a tool like CPU-Z to see your current RAM configuration.

Compatible RAM:

  • Your system supports DDR4-2400 SODIMM (laptop-sized) RAM.
  • You can go for 8 GB (2x4 GB) or 16 GB (2x8 GB) depending on your need and budget.
  • Ensure the RAM sticks are of the same frequency (2400 MHz) for compatibility.

Max Capacity:

  • The maximum supported RAM is 16 GB (2x8 GB DDR4-2400).

Installation:

  • Shut down the PC, unplug it, and remove the back panel.
  • Locate the RAM slots, remove the old stick if needed, and insert the new ones.

After the upgrade, check the system properties to verify that the new RAM has been recognized.
